ACCESS ROAD REAR OF 75 - 113 STATION ROAD, WEST WICKHAM - PROPOSED MAKING_UP UNDER PRIVATE STREET WORKS PROCEDURE

Decision:

The Portfolio Holder made a First Resolution under s.205(1) of the Highways Act 1980 in respect of the access road to the rear of 75 – 113 Station Road, West Wickham, as follows:

 

‘The Council do hereby declare that the access road to the rear of 75-113 Station Road, West Wickham is not sewered, levelled, paved, metalled, flagged, channelled, made good and lighted to its satisfaction and therefore resolves to execute street works therein, under the provisions of the Private Street Works Code, as set out in the Highways Act 1980.’

 

Schedule of Works

 

From the junction of the access road with Croft Avenue to the north, for a distance of 98.0m to the south, as shown on Drg. No. P2359 PAR-ZZ-XX-DR-C 8100.

 

The Portfolio Holder approved the proposed layout to which it was proposed that the access road be made-up all as shown on Drg. No. P2359-ZZ-XX-DR-C 8100.

 

The Portfolio Holder agreed that in this instance, the Council meets all the expenses of the Private Street Works scheme, under the provisions of s.236 of the Highways Act 1980.

 

Reasons for the decision:

The Council needed to exercise its powers under the Private Street Works (PSW) Code contained in the Highways Act 1980, to make-up and adopt an existing service road in order that it may provide a suitable means of access to a proposed housing development at the rear of West Wickham Library.
